Surgical Technician / Technologist jobs in Manatee, Florida involve assisting during surgical procedures, preparing operating rooms, and sterilizing equipment. Duties include handing instruments to surgeons, monitoring patients, and maintaining a sterile environment. These roles require strong attention to detail, knowledge of medical terminology, and certification in surgical technology. Salary Information & Job Trends In this Region
Surgical Technicians / Technologists in Manatee, Florida play a crucial role in assisting surgeons during medical procedures. - Entry-level Surgical Technician salaries range from $30,000 to $40,000 per year - Mid-career Surgical Technologist salaries range from $40,000 to $55,000 per year - Senior-level Surgical Specialist salaries range from $55,000 to $75,000 per year The history of Surgical Technicians in Manatee, Florida dates back to the early days of modern surgery, where specialized assistants were needed to support the work of surgeons in operating rooms. As the field of surgery has evolved over time, Surgical Technicians in Manatee, Florida have adapted to new technologies, procedures, and best practices to ensure the highest standards of patient care and safety. Current trends in Surgical Technology in Manatee, Florida include advancements in minimally invasive techniques, increased focus on infection control protocols, and the integration of electronic health records to streamline patient care processes.
